Russian Plot To Assassinate Ukraine President Zelensky Foiled, 2 Ukrainian Officials Held

Ukraine's SBU State Security Service said it had caught Russian agents within the Ukrainian state guard service plotting the kidnap and assassination of the president and other senior govt officials.

New Delhi: The Ukrainian Security Service (SBU) on Tuesday claimed to have thwarted a sinister plot orchestrated by Russian operatives to assassinate President Volodymyr Zelensky and other prominent Ukrainian officials. 

This revelation comes in the wake of the arrest of two colonels from the Ukrainian government protection unit, who are alleged to have been part of a covert network operating on behalf of the Russian State Security Service (FSB). 

According to the SBU, these individuals were actively seeking accomplices among President Zelensky's bodyguards, with the chilling intent of orchestrating his abduction and subsequent murder. 

Furthermore, the SBU has disclosed that the targets of this nefarious plot extended beyond the Ukrainian president, encompassing other high-ranking officials such as military intelligence head Kyrylo Budanov and SBU chief Vasyl Malyuk, reported BBC.

The force said they arrested the two suspected “moles” who they believed had been recruited by Russia before their invasion.

The Security Service of Ukraine (SBU) claimed that a Russian secret agent divulged the coordinates of a safe house ahead of a planned rocket attack, indicating a calculated attempt to target the Ukrainian leader.

Moreover, the SBU said that Russia intended to obliterate any evidence of its involvement by deploying another missile to destroy the drone used in the assault. The Head of the SBU, Vasyl Malyuk said: “A limited number of people knew about our special operation, and I personally monitored its progress, as per Independent.

“The terrorist attack, which was supposed to be a gift to Putin before the inauguration, was actually a failure of the Russian special services.

“But we must not forget - the enemy is strong and experienced, he cannot be underestimated. We will continue to work ahead of time, so that every traitor receives the well-deserved court sentences.”

Ukrainian authorities, following the arrests of the two suspected officers implicated in the alleged plot, have claimed significant findings during subsequent searches.
